是指通过计算机程序获取屏幕上某个特定点的像素值,即该点所显示的颜色。这一功能可以在各种应用场景中使用,例如图像处理、屏幕截图、屏幕取色器等。
获取屏幕上的像素颜色可以通过编程语言中的图形库或系统调用来实现。以下是一个常见的实现示例:
- 使用前端开发技术:
- HTML5的Canvas元素和相关JavaScript API提供了获取屏幕像素颜色的功能。通过获取鼠标点击事件的位置,可以使用
getImageData()
方法获取特定坐标的像素数据,并进一步获取其颜色值。
- 使用后端开发技术:
- Python的Pillow库或OpenCV库可以在后端实现获取屏幕像素颜色的功能。通过调用相应的库函数,可以获取屏幕截图,并进一步获取指定像素的颜色值。
获取屏幕上的像素颜色可以在以下场景中应用:
- 图像处理:通过获取屏幕像素颜色,可以对屏幕截图进行分析、处理、识别,例如色彩校正、图像滤波等。
- 屏幕取色器:可以通过获取屏幕像素颜色来获取某个特定点的颜色值,以便进行配色、设计、调试等工作。
- 屏幕截图工具:获取屏幕上的像素颜色可以用于屏幕截图工具,可以实现屏幕截图中取色器的功能。
腾讯云相关产品中,与获取屏幕上的像素颜色相关的服务可能包含在以下产品中:
- 腾讯云图像处理(Image Processing):提供了丰富的图像处理能力,包括颜色校正、图像滤波等,可用于处理获取的屏幕像素颜色。
- 腾讯云API网关(API Gateway):可用于构建自定义的后端服务,通过调用相应的自定义API实现获取屏幕像素颜色的功能。
需要注意的是,由于禁止提及特定的云计算品牌商,以上产品只是举例,并非推荐或限制使用的产品。具体选择使用哪个产品需要根据需求和业务场景来决定。
参考链接: